In a study reported in this paper, the time series data of <i>S. furcifera</i> field occurrence level from 1900 to 2011 in Jinping, a quaternary middle rice-growing area in Guizhou, were selected to establish a probability transfer matrix of 1 to 5 steps according to Markov chain theory, and to forecast, based on the continuous occurrence level of the previous five years, the occurrence of the pest in the sixth year. When used to reversely forecast the occurrence of <i>S. furcifera</i> in Jinping in the preceding 17 years, this matrix gave a satisfactory historical coincident rate (82%), and the results based on prediction in 2012 of Jinping were also consistent with the real situation of the year %K 白背飞虱 %K 预测预报 %K 马尔科夫链 %K 发生程度< %K br> %K white-backed planthopper (< %K i> %K Sogatella furcifera< %K /i> %K ) %K forecast %K Markov chain %K occurrence degree %U http://xbgjxt.swu.edu.cn/jsuns/html/jsuns/2017/8/201708006.htm
